Canary gating for Ferrowind deploys. Canary gets 5% traffic for 30 minutes. Auto-promote only if: error rate delta under 0.2%, p99 latency within 10% of baseline, zero new panic signatures. Any breach triggers auto-rollback; do not override without a second maintainer. Manual promotion requires the gate checklist completed in order. Gate thresholds live in the pipeline config, not the service repo. The full gating policy and override procedure are documented at the page below.

wiki page, tahaf-tajog: https://jira.ordindyn.corp/pipeline

## Deploying the Gatewick Proctor Queue

Deploys are pretty painless: push to main, wait for the pipeline, then watch the queue drain dashboard for five minutes. If candidates pile up mid-exam, roll back first and ask questions later — the queue replays safely. Everything the workers care about lives in one config block, shown here for reference.

settings of bafof-yagef:
JOROX_PIN=8740
JOROX_TENANT=pelox
JOROX_METRICS_HOST=metrics.jorox.qorvelworks.internal
JOROX_SEAL=seal_c78f63c1
JOROX_STANDBY_TEAM=norax

Welcome to the Pointsmith release rotation. Pointsmith is the internal ledger that records loyalty-point accruals and redemptions for the Lumora storefront. As release manager, you validate ledger snapshots before each deploy by calling the reconciliation endpoint and confirming balances match the prior epoch. Discrepancies above 0.01% block the release automatically. All reconciliation calls go through the Pointsmith gateway, which requires authenticated requests. Use the internal service key below for these checks.

service key, kaduf-bawig: kto15_Ze79S0dligTw0yO

# Service account: remindbot-clinic

Purpose: nightly job sending appointment reminders for the Pinewick Clinic scheduler. Scope: read-only on appointment slots, send-only on the NotifyHub queue. No patient record access. Rotation: quarterly. Owner: scheduling platform team. Reviewer note: job runs in the isolated batch cluster only. Current credential for the NotifyHub service is as follows.

service key, fawip-bajef: kto11_Qt5wZK9vdNC